NRS 449A.109 - Specific rights: Designation of persons authorized to visit patient in facility.

Universal Citation: NV Rev Stat § 449A.109 (2022)

1. If, as a result of the incapacitation of a patient or the inability of a patient to communicate, the patient of a medical facility or facility for the dependent who is 18 years of age or older is unable to inform the staff of the facility of the persons whom the patient authorizes to visit the patient at the facility, the facility shall allow visitation rights to any person designated by the patient in a letter, form or other document authorizing visitation executed in accordance with subsection 2. The visitation rights required by this subsection must be:

(a) Provided in accordance with the visitation policies of the facility; and

(b) The same visitation rights that are provided to a member of the patient’s family who is legally related to the patient.

2. A person 18 years of age or older wishing to designate a person for the purposes of establishing visitation rights in a medical facility or facility for the dependent may execute a letter, form or other document authorizing visitation in substantially the following form:

(Date)..................................

I, ..............................., (patient who is designating another person as having visitation rights of the patient) do hereby designate .................................. (person who is being designated as having visitation rights of the patient) as having the right to visit me in a medical facility or facility for the dependent. I hereby instruct all staff of a medical facility or facility for the dependent in which I am a patient to admit ...................................... (person who is being designated as having visitation rights of the patient) to my room and afford him or her the same visitation rights as are provided to members of my family who are legally related to me during my time as a patient.

........................................................

(Signed)

(Added to NRS by 2003, 1879; A 2011, 361)—(Substituted in revision for NRS 449.715)
